SH-Oligopeptide-2
SH-Oligopeptide-2 — a synthetic analogue of IGF-1 (Insulin-like Growth Factor 1) that stimulates the metabolism of fibroblasts and collagen synthesis. It differs from EGF analogues in its specificity to IGF receptors — complements EGF for a more complete anti-aging effect.
What is it?
SH-Oligopeptide-2 (INCI: SH-Oligopeptide-2) — a synthetic oligopeptide analogue of IGF-1 (Somatomedin C). Natural IGF-1: a 70-amino acid polypeptide synthesized in the liver under the influence of GH (growth hormone). MW of natural IGF-1: ~7,649 Da. SH-oligopeptide-2: a shorter peptide fragment with IGF-1-like activity. Mechanism: IGF-1R (IGF-1 receptor) → IRS-1/IRS-2 phosphorylation → PI3K/Akt/mTOR (anabolism, protein synthesis) + MAPK/ERK (proliferation). In the skin: IGF-1R on fibroblasts, keratinocytes, melanocytes. Key difference from EGF: IGF-1 is more specific for dermal fibroblasts and metabolic processes (not just proliferation).
Anti-aging serums and creams for dermal restoration, products for mature skin with pronounced loss of elasticity, combinations with EGF analogues for synergistic effect.

SH-Oligopeptide-2 = IGF-1 analogue for topical application. Effective concentration: 0.001-0.01%. INCI: SH-Oligopeptide-2. Less studied than EGF analogues — fewer clinical studies specifically for cosmetics. Store at 2-8°C. Water-soluble, pH-stable 4-8. Like EGF analogues: consult a doctor in case of oncological diseases. Most effective in combination with EGF (SH-oligopeptide-1 or SH-polypeptide-1).
